Shanghai's Huangxing Park is a must-visit destination for several compelling reasons:
1. Green Oasis: Located in the bustling city of Shanghai, Huangxing Park offers a serene escape from the urban hustle and bustle, providing a refreshing green space for relaxation and recreation.
2. Cultural Significance: The park is named after Huang Xing, a prominent figure in modern Chinese history, and serves as a tribute to his contributions to the nation, making it a place of historical and cultural importance.
3. Scenic Beauty: With its well-maintained gardens, picturesque lakes, and walking paths, the park is a feast for the eyes, offering beautiful views and a perfect backdrop for photography enthusiasts.
4. Recreational Facilities: Huangxing Park is equipped with various recreational facilities such as playgrounds, sports fields, and exercise equipment, making it an ideal spot for families and fitness enthusiasts.
5. Community Events: The park often hosts community events, festivals, and performances, providing visitors with a chance to experience local culture and traditions.
6. Accessibility: Situated in a convenient location, the park is easily accessible by public transportation, making it a convenient destination for both locals and tourists.
7. Ecological Value: As an urban park, Huangxing Park plays a crucial role in maintaining the ecological balance of the city, providing a habitat for various species of flora and fauna.
8. Educational Opportunities: The park can serve as an outdoor classroom for children and adults alike, offering opportunities to learn about local plant and animal species, as well as environmental conservation.
9. Wellness and Relaxation: The tranquil environment of the park is perfect for practicing mindfulness, yoga, or simply enjoying a moment of peace amidst the city's vibrancy.
10. Photography and Art Inspiration: The park's natural beauty and architectural elements provide endless inspiration for photographers, artists, and anyone seeking a creative retreat.
